Responsibilities:


* Ensures that employees receive compliance training and education necessary to perform their job responsibilities in accordance with Avamere Code of Business Conduct.


* Oversees the process for competency evaluation of new clinical department personnel; recommends progression to permanent employment or extension of orientation/probationary period for new employees.


* Plans, organizes, and implements ongoing education and training programs for licensed nurses, nursing assistants, unit clerks, and other ancillary personnel to promote the knowledge and skills necessary for the provision of quality care consistent with services provided by the center.


* In coordination with the Director of Nursing and the Administrator, periodically reviews the center Clinical Admission Grid and service lines to identify applicable advanced/as needed competencies required for clinical personnel.


* Plans, organizes, and implements education training programs to meet the strategic goals of the center.
